Indonesia Distribution Automation Market Overview

The distribution automation market in Indonesia focuses on optimizing the operation and control of electrical distribution networks. Automation technologies, including advanced sensors, communication systems, and intelligent devices, are deployed to enhance grid reliability, reduce losses, and enable rapid fault detection and response. The market is driven by the imperative to modernize aging distribution infrastructure and adapt to the evolving energy landscape. Government-backed initiatives and partnerships between utilities and technology providers are key drivers for market growth.

Drivers of the Market

The distribution automation market in Indonesia is growing as utilities aim to improve grid reliability and reduce energy losses. Automated systems enable utilities to monitor and control the distribution network more effectively, leading to fewer outages and optimized energy delivery.

Challenges of the Market

The distribution automation market faces challenges in terms of upgrading existing infrastructure to incorporate smart grid technologies. This involves not only technological advancements but also navigating regulatory frameworks and ensuring cybersecurity.

COVID-19 Impacts on the Market

The distribution automation market was affected as infrastructure projects faced disruptions, and utilities were challenged to maintain service continuity. The pandemic highlighted the importance of resilient grids, likely leading to increased investment in automation solutions for better grid management.

Key Players of the Makret

Indonesia`s power sector has seen significant growth and transformation in recent years, and several key markets within the sector have experienced notable developments. In the distribution automation market, prominent players such as Schneider Electric, Siemens, and ABB have been pivotal in driving the adoption of advanced technologies for efficient power distribution across the archipelago.
